其他分享
首页 > 其他分享> > android括号内文字修改颜色 数据后台返回

android括号内文字修改颜色 数据后台返回

作者:互联网

String name = payChannelListDTO.getName();

String subNameA = name.substring(0, name.indexOf("(")+1);
String subNameB = name.substring(name.indexOf(")"));
String quStr=name.substring(name.indexOf("(")+1,name.indexOf(")"));

String replace = subNameB.replace("\\n", "\n");//遇到\n换行(可不加)
SpannableString ss = new SpannableString(quStr);
ForegroundColorSpan span = new ForegroundColorSpan(Color.RED);

ss.setSpan(span, 0, quStr.length(), Spannable.SPAN_EXCLUSIVE_EXCLUSIVE);

标签:name,indexOf,substring,括号,quStr,后台,android,ss,String
来源: https://blog.csdn.net/chenxchhh/article/details/123040415